i Dear Betty Crocker Q. I wrap parsnips in aluminum - foil and bake them. Can I freeze parsnips in the same wrap? Do they freeze well? Ms. H.F.M. Morrisville, Vt. A. Parsnips will keep frozen for a year. For best results, take them from the aluminum foil and place them in freezer containers or bags allowing extra space for them to ex pand during freezing. Q. I make iced tea by brewing it with sugar and cooling to room temperature before refrigerating. Then, it becomes cloudv. Wh»t ran I do to avoid this? Ms. M.H. Johnstown, Pa. A. Make blear tea by placing tea in cold water in a glass container; cover and refrigerate for 24 hours. Or, use boiling water and don’t steep longer than 3-5 minutes. Cool to room temperature and pour over ice cubes. If tea does become cloudy, pour a lit tle boiling water into it to clear. Do you have a question" Write “Dear Betty Crocker,” Box 1113, Dept.
